You can activate an AP at any Guest Relations -or- any Ticket Window.

Those will be open at the parks and TTC:
90 minutes before "regular" hours.
30 minutes before AM EMH begins.

You can order the voucher to be mailed to you, or you can order it "will-call."

Either way, when you get to parking, just pay the attendant and keep your RECEIPT.
When you get the AP activated, you can get a full refund for parking that first day at the same time.

The MBs to which they are referring are your regular WDW Resort MBs.

Your APs WILL be able to be used with those regular MBs for this trip (once you activate the APs at a guest relations.)
You will also get an AP CARD (at the Guest Relations during activation) that must be shown when you are getting AP discounts during this trip.

THEN, after you return from this trip, you need to customize your "AP MagicBands."
